Device Detection on Angel.com is done through the Outbound API.
An option is provided under the Outbound site properties page to Enable/Disable Outbound Calling and transfer the call to specific voice site pages depending on the results of the device detection. NOTE : You can set the call to be routed to different voice page depending on device detection ( Human or Voicemail )
Note: Barge-in and Site Commands MUST be disabled on ONLY the first voice site (transfered to when a Human is detected) if using Outbound, Device Detection, and Voice Recognition together.
This is important because on an Outbound Call the Voice Site MUST first give instructions and then listen for responses. If the person being called speaks hello followed by something it must be ignored and NOT taken as a response to the Voice Site. Otherwise, you may hear "I didn't get that." or the prompt being repeated.
If you are having problems with the Outbound Device Detection (long pauses after the Outbound Call Connect to the phone number) try the Device Detection Settings on the Outbound properties page.
